Tshwane council approves key step towards formalisation of Refilwe Extension 5 informal settlement

# The City of Tshwane council has approved a request by the Department of Human Settlements to issue a Power of Attorney for various land-use applications. This is required to formalise the existing Refilwe Extension 5 Informal Settlement. The applications may include rezoning, subdivision, township establishment, and removal of restrictive title conditions. The department says it intends to formalise the Refilwe settlement, which covers 12.8 hectares, as part of the metro’s broader programme to provide secure tenure, improve living conditions and ensure sustainable human settlements.
